You have the ability to grant inventory permissions to your FTM internal providers who deal with your inventory in the ServiceChannel Provider mobile app. This allows you to control who can update inventory data and what inventory data can be modified.Inventory permissions for FTM providers

Inventory Permissions for FTM Internal Providers

Here are the permissions you can set:

  • View Stock: Allows providers to view stock records. This permission is enabled by default for all of your providers.

    A stock record includes information (part name, number, type, available quantity, etc.) on a particular part that is on hand at your inventory location.

  • Create Stock: Empowers providers to add new stock records to inventory locations.

  • Modify Stock Properties: Permits providers to update existing stock records except for the part quantity on hand.
  • Stock Adjustments Audit: Grants the ability to edit the part quantity that is on hand at a location.
  • Create Transfers: Enables technicians to create transfers via the SC Provider mobile app.  
  • Receive Inventory: Enables technicians to mark inventory transfer items as received via the SC Provider mobile app.

Please note that the list of available permissions may vary based on the set of inventory features enabled for your company.

Assigning Inventory Permissions to FTM Providers

Check the steps below to learn how you can grant your FTM internal providers the ability to manage inventory via the SC Provider.

⦿ How to Assign Inventory Permissions to Providers
  1. Click the hamburger menu in the upper-left corner, and select Admin > Inventory Permissions > Providers. The list of all your providers opens.List of inventory permissions for FTM providers
  2. Find the desired provider on the list using the available filters. You can find providers either by their company name or ID.
  3. To the right of the provider name, select the checkbox from the desired columns with permissions:

    • View Stock
    • Create Stock
    • Receive Inventory
    • Modify Stock Properties
    • Create Transfers
    • Stock Adjustments Audit

The provider is assigned inventory permissions. When they access the Inventory module in ServiceChannel Provider, they can perform actions based on the permissions given to them.
